Honestly, I was hesitant to review this place because I wanted to keep it a secret. I'm mainly vegetarian, but I do eat meat on occasion, and this place has an incredibly fresh selection, so I can't wait to pick some up for the next BBQ. I come here for their huge selection of bulk beans, lentils, and spices. They're well priced and great quality. Also, the soaps and snacks here aren't filled with dyes and preservatives, so it's a great place to pick up minor toiletries while you're shopping. If you're buying spices, check out "Shah's Deer Brand." It's high quality, and I'm mildly obsessed with their curry blends because they make everything I cook taste amazing. Here are a few recent dishes I've made with their ingredients. The first is stewed red beans, with shredded carrots spiced with garam masala, and plain greek yogurt sprinkled with garlic and onion. The second is black eyed peas spiced with garam masala, soy sauce, hot curry, cumin, and other spices, with kale marinated in pressed garlic, white wine vinegar, lemon juice, mild curry, and olive oil. The last is stewed red beans, spiced with garam masala, mild curry, garlic, onions, chili powder, and brown sugar. All of the beans and spices were purchased here, but other than onions and garlic, you'll need to get your produce at a grocery store.

Hassan and Leo are amazing. I called ahead with a special request for mutton, which is very hard to find in LA. Hassan said he would get me some and to come in a couple of days. When I went he pulled out the entire carcass and asked me which parts I wanted, and the butcher Leo cut it up for me. He also answered my many questions about which cuts would be good for different purposes and overall is just super knowledgeable. I vacuum packed everything when I got home so it stays fresh for as long as possible. They also gave me tips and recipe ideas for curry, their spices are really great and authentic tasting as well. I made the curry last night with my girlfriend and we both agree it’s some of the best meat we’ve ever had. Super fresh, flavorful, and tender. I will absolutely be back when we run out and I honestly can’t imagine myself buying lamb/mutton from a grocery store ever again, as long as I have time to make the drive to No Ho Halal Meat & Grocery. If you need high quality meat of any kind, and at a fair price, call them!
